#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dbool.h>
#include <stdint.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<limits.h>
#include <time.h>
#include "bacport.h"
#include "bacnet/basic/sys/mstimer.h"
/* Windows timer period - in milliseconds */
static unsigned long Timer_Period = 1;
/**
* @brief returns the current millisecond count
* @return millisecond counter
*/
unsigned long mstimer_now(void)
{
return timeGetTime();
}
/**
* @brief Shut down for timer
*/
static void timer_cleanup(void)
{
timeEndPeriod(Timer_Period);
}
/**
* @brief Initialization for timer
*/
void mstimer_init(void)
{
TIMECAPS tc;
/* set timer resolution */
if (timeGetDevCaps(&tc, sizeof(TIMECAPS)) != TIMERR_NOERROR) {
fprintf(stderr, "Failed to get timer resolution parameters\n");
}
/* configure for 1ms resolution - if possible */
Timer_Period = min(max(tc.wPeriodMin, 1L), tc.wPeriodMax);
if (Timer_Period != 1L) {
fprintf(stderr,
"Failed to set timer to 1ms. "
"Time period set to %ums\n",
(unsigned)Timer_Period);
}
timeBeginPeriod(Timer_Period);
atexit(timer_cleanup);
}
